Since then he has appeared in 70 more films, including "Kingdom" 1 & 2, "The Adventures of Pinnochio", "Medea", "For Love or Money", "Breaking the Waves", "Blade", "Ace Ventura" (opposite Jim Carrey), "Armageddon", and "End of Days" (opposite Arnold Schwarzenegger). In 1991, Udo met director Gus van Sant in Berlin, where he was offered the role of Hans in "My Own Private Idaho", which was so much of a success that he stayed in America.
In the twenty years that followed, Udo appeared in roughly 40 films, mostly European films, where he was recognized more. But the two films that made him a cult character were "Flesh for Frankenstein" (aka Andy Warhol's Frankenstein), and "Blood for Dracula" (aka Andy Warhol's Dracula), in which both he played the main character. His plan never became a reality, as he starred in his first hit four years later, the German film "Hexen bis aufs Blut gequ?lt", which is notorious for its exploitation of violence and sex. Having already earned an accounting degree in Cologne, his plan was to become fluent in English and French in order to secure an important, high-salaried position with a major international import-export conglomerate. That night the hospital was bombed, and all the people died, except for Udo and his mother, who saw the wall collapsing. In the hospital while the nurses were collecting the newborn babies, his mother asked that she be with Udo five more minutes. Udo Kier, the cult film star who has appeared in over 100 films, was born on October 14, 1944, at Cologne, Germany.
